The Mediation Committee at Moraine Camplands is dedicated to facilitating peaceful resolutions to conflicts and disputes that may arise among members. Their primary objective is to maintain a harmonious environment by providing a neutral space where parties can discuss issues and find amicable solutions.
Key Responsibilities:
Conflict Resolution: The committee works with members to address disagreements and misunderstandings, offering mediation services to help resolve issues in a fair and respectful manner.
Preventive Measures: They provide guidance on conflict avoidance and promote communication strategies to reduce tensions before they escalate.
Support: The committee serves as a support system for members, offering resources or advice on handling conflicts and fostering a positive community atmosphere.
Through their efforts, the Mediation Committee helps create an environment that encourages open dialogue, understanding, and cooperation among all members of the campground.
